Exploring Ethernet-Based Modules: Revolutionizing Connectivity in IoT

Ethernet-based modules are hardware components that enable devices to connect to a network using Ethernet protocols. These modules facilitate data transfer over wired networks, providing reliable and high-speed communication.

Key Features of Ethernet-Based Modules

  • High-Speed Connectivity: Ethernet modules offer fast data transmission rates, making them ideal for applications requiring real-time data exchange.
  • Reliability: Wired connections are generally more stable and less prone to interference compared to wireless alternatives.
  • Scalability: Easily expand your network by adding more devices without compromising performance.
  • Standard Protocols: They support standard Ethernet protocols, ensuring compatibility with a wide range of devices and systems.

Applications of Ethernet-Based Modules

Ethernet-based modules find applications across various industries and use cases, including:

  1. Industrial Automation: Used in manufacturing for machine-to-machine communication and monitoring.
  2. Smart Homes: Enable seamless connectivity between smart devices, allowing for centralized control and automation.
  3. Healthcare: Connect medical devices to networks for real-time monitoring and data sharing.
  4. IoT Solutions: Form the backbone of IoT systems, facilitating communication between sensors, actuators, and cloud services.

Choosing the Right Ethernet-Based Module

When selecting an Ethernet-based module, consider the following factors:

  • Data Rate: Ensure the module supports the required data transmission speed for your application.
  • Power Consumption: Look for energy-efficient modules, especially for battery-powered devices.
  • Size and Form Factor: Choose a module that fits your project’s physical dimensions and design requirements.
  • Compatibility: Verify that the module is compatible with your existing hardware and software systems.
